Etihad Airways to add daily flight to Venice

Etihad Airways will expand its services to Italy with a daily flight to Venice Marco Polo Airport.

The new service will begin from October 30, 2016. Together with Alitalia, its codeshare and equity partner, Etihad Airways will offer 35 weekly flights in and out of Italy, including double daily services to Rome and Milan.

Kevin Knight, Etihad Airways’ chief strategy and planning officer, said: “Launching our service to Venice further supports a very popular passenger route between Italy, our Abu Dhabi hub and onwards throughout Etihad Airways’ growing network, as far afield as Australia. Together with our codeshare and equity partner Alitalia, we are also strengthening the significant trade relationship between Italy and the UAE.”
